Project Objective

The objective of this project is to design machine safeguarding for a 1967 Besly Dual Disk grinder that improves operator safety without lowering output efficiency.

Selection Realignment

  • Light Bar Considerations
    • Splash from grinding disk coolant
    • Metal dust in coolant
  • Push-Back Sensor
    • Adjustable limit switch that can be set at varying distances to control proximity between the machine’s moving parts and danger zones

Lucas Salcedo

Team 511: DR4

28

29 of 63

Final Selection

  • Adjusted Concept: Push Back Finger Sensor with Slide actuated Limit Switch

    • Minimal space consumption
    • Can use existing wiring
    • Leaves dial open
    • Self-resetting
